How much do entry level motion graphics designer j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 13, 2026, the average hourly pay for entry level motion graphics designer in California is $36.36,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$27.50 and $41.97 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are some common challenges faced by entry level motion graphics designers in their first year?

Entry level motion graphics designers often encounter challenges such as managing tight deadlines, adapting to different creative directions, and mastering new software tools quickly. Collaboration with teams like video editors, art directors, and clients can also require strong communication skills to ensure the final animations align with project goals. Additionally, balancing creativity with technical requirements and client feedback is a valuable skill developed over time, helping designers grow professionally and contribute effectively to projects.

What is the difference between Entry Level Motion Graphics Designer vs Junior Video Editor?

AspectEntry Level Motion Graphics DesignerJunior Video Editor
Required SkillsAdobe After Effects, Photoshop, basic animationAdobe Premiere Pro, Final Cut Pro, basic editing
Work EnvironmentDesign studios, advertising agencies, media companiesBroadcast stations, production houses, media companies
Typical TasksCreate animated graphics, visual effects, titlesEdit raw footage, assemble scenes, add sound

Both roles often require proficiency in Adobe Creative Suite and are found in media and advertising industries. An Entry Level Motion Graphics Designer focuses on creating animated visuals and effects, while a Junior Video Editor primarily edits and assembles video footage. While skills may overlap, their core responsibilities differ, making each role distinct in the production process.

What does an Entry Level Motion Graphics Designer do?

An Entry Level Motion Graphics Designer creates animated graphics and visual effects for various media, such as videos, advertisements, and presentations. They typically work with software like Adobe After Effects, Illustrator, and Photoshop to bring static designs to life. Entry level designers often assist senior team members, follow creative briefs, and help implement visual concepts that enhance storytelling and communication. Their work is crucial in making content more engaging and visually appealing.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Entry Level Motion Graphics Designer,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Entry Level Motion Graphics Designer, you need a solid grasp of design principles, animation techniques, and a relevant degree or coursework in graphic design or a related field. Proficiency in industry-standard software such as Adobe After Effects, Premiere Pro, and Illustrator is typically required. Creativity, attention to detail, and the ability to collaborate effectively within a team are crucial soft skills. These competencies are important because they enable designers to produce engaging visual content that meets client needs and project objectives efficiently.

WeVote has an open volunteering position for a Motion Graphics Designer-Animator, Video Team (2-3 hours per week) who wants to use their existing skills and learn new skills while helping strengthen American Democracy.
About Us
WeVote is a nonpartisan get-out-the-vote nonprofit startup and a celebrated Fast Forward nonprofit technology grantee. WeVote is a movement of over 60 passionate volunteers (starting with the founders) who are building open-source mobile technologies that touch and mobilize millions of voters on Election Day. We observe that many voters are busy, distracted, and impatient. We have a goal of providing a complete voting experience in 8 minutes, including the download of our app ("WeVote Ballot Guide, @WeVote"). More information is at https://WeVote.US. See Twitter @WeVote. We are a 100% volunteer and remote organization.
WeVote is seeking a passionate and creative Motion Designer to join our volunteer team. In this role, you will be instrumental in building animated assets and motion graphics for Wevote's social channels and promoting Wevote and Democracy. Your expertise in Motion Graphics & Animation will resonate with our audience across various platforms. You should be proficient in Adobe After Effects and other related Adobe CC apps. This volunteer position is ideal for individuals who are enthusiastic about storytelling through video and are looking to make an impact with their creative skills.
